Hypercasual game

They also often use a 2D design with a simple color scheme, easy mechanics adding to their simplicity.

[citation needed] These games are often played while multitasking, which is why their simple user interface is essential.

[1] Because of the lack of a robust in-game economy and free download cost of most hyper-causal games, revenue is mostly generated from ads.

The first hypercasual game that gained wide popularity was Flappy Bird, which saw over 50 million downloads and generated around $50,000 a day in its prime.

[4] In 2017, Goldman Sachs invested $200 million in hypercasual gaming company Voodoo.
